DiGRA: Candidate for Executive Board – Thomas Rousse (Secretary)

Thomas Rousse, Nomination for Secretary:

POSITION STATEMENT: If I have the opportunity to serve as Secretary, I will have four priorities: 1.) ensuring meetings and events are scheduled and conducted as efficiently and as painlessly as possible; 2.) disseminating the actions of the board in concise but complete minutes to the general listserv within 48 hours of every meeting; 3.) soliciting and supporting agenda items from outside the executive board; and 4.) following up on all points of action or requests for information decided upon in the minutes. I’ve served on more than a dozen executive boards and I’ve worked in a research lab as an administrative assistant, so I have a fair amount of experience in juggling schedules and taking minutes. I typically take detailed minutes for record keeping purposes and provide a 150-200 word executive summary; I’m more than happy to work with the new executive board or the needs and interests of the membership to make the minutes more useful and effective. I hope I can be of service to DiGRA.

BIO: Thomas Rousse has just completed his first year of study at IT University of Copenhagen’s Games MSc. His research interests include free speech and censorship, novel forms of expression, and the experimental use of games to gather network data. After completing his undergraduate studies at Northwestern University, he worked as a qualitative research assistant at Noshir Contractor’s Science of Networks in Communities. He currently serves as producer on LAZA KNITEZ!!, a retro-style arcade game that recently won the Indie Sensation Award at Nordic Game 2012.
